Transaction 104fc686dc73fba35acb5718c11c8d10b05eee30a725c95b50e35c3b48e7285a
1 Input
2 Outputs
- 104fc686dc73fba35acb5718c11c8d10b05eee30a725c95b50e35c3b48e7285a:0
- 104fc686dc73fba35acb5718c11c8d10b05eee30a725c95b50e35c3b48e7285a:1
value 2751736
address 17Y5guYSD47PviXb1QxcSDYSteahDbeqMB
value 539574924
address 1FWWSiADRm5yh34d3XuxkuJHAZZrnXEPpa